What is the salary of an Audit Analyst? In the United States, an Audit Analyst earns an average salary of $66,812. The salary range for an Audit Analyst is usually between $45,200 and $81,883 per year, representing the 25th to 75th percentiles respectively. The top 10% of earners, that is the 90th percentile, have an annual salary of $168,925. The highest Audit Analyst salary in the United States was $168,925. The average hourly pay for an Audit Analyst is $32.12.
Top 3 states paying the highest average Audit Analyst salary are California, with an average salary of $87,329, followed by Maine, with an average salary of $81,883, and Texas, with an average salary of $71,138.
